Frontotemporal dementia: a randomised, controlled trial with trazodone.

Florence Lebert1, Willy Stekke, Christine Hasenbroekx

  • 1Memory Clinic, Lille University Hospital, Lille, France. flebert@nordnet.fr

Dementia and Geriatric Cognitive Disorders
|June 5, 2004
PubMed
Summary

Trazodone effectively treats behavioral problems in frontotemporal dementia (FTD). This study found significant improvements in irritability, agitation, and depressive symptoms, with the medication being well-tolerated by patients.

Background:

  • Behavioral disturbances are a significant challenge in managing frontotemporal dementia (FTD).
  • The frontal lobes, affected in FTD, are closely linked to the serotonergic system.
  • Trazodone is known to enhance extracellular serotonin levels in the frontal cortex.

Purpose of the Study:

  • To evaluate the efficacy of trazodone in managing behavioral symptoms associated with frontotemporal dementia (FTD).

Main Methods:

  • A randomized, double-blind, placebo-controlled, cross-over study design was employed.
  • The study included 26 evaluable patients diagnosed with FTD.
  • The Neuropsychiatry Inventory (NPI) was used to assess behavioral symptoms, with the Mini-Mental State Examination (MMSE) also administered.

Main Results:

  • Trazodone significantly reduced the total Neuropsychiatry Inventory (NPI) score (p = 0.028).
  • Over 50% reduction in NPI score was achieved by 10 patients receiving trazodone.
  • Improvements were noted in specific symptoms including irritability, agitation, depressive symptoms, and eating disorders.
  • No significant changes were observed in Mini-Mental State Examination (MMSE) scores.

Conclusions:

  • Trazodone demonstrates effectiveness in treating behavioral symptoms of frontotemporal dementia (FTD).
  • The medication was well-tolerated by participants in this study.
  • These findings suggest trazodone as a potential therapeutic option for FTD-related behavioral issues.
